Step 7: Enable hot-reload. Plugin authors, good news — the Kindlewick runtime now picks up config changes without a restart. Drop your updated manifest into the watch directory and the loader reparses it within a few seconds. One catch: reloaded manifests are only trusted if they carry a valid signature, so sign yours with the key below.

release key, fahaf-bajof: bky3_Xam

**Visitor policy: Night-shift support access.** Members of the Larkfield support team working overnight at Greyholt House enter via the service door on Penman Lane, as the main lobby is unstaffed after 22:00. Facilities desk staff should verify each person against the overnight roster before issuing access. All entries are logged automatically. The service door keypad is reset monthly; the current code for authorised support staff is:

door code, yagap-bahof: bdg-O-05

## Sensor drift: what to do at 3am

If the GrowLoop controller starts reporting humidity swings that don't match the backup probes in the Fernwick greenhouse, it's almost always sensor drift, not an actual climate event. Don't panic and don't touch the vents manually. First, restart the calibration daemon and give it ten minutes to re-baseline. If readings still disagree by more than 5%, flip the controller into safe mode. The safe-mode thresholds it will use are these.

config for yahap-bajof:
[istix]
host = istix.qorvelsys.internal
user = istix_svc
database = istix_prod

/*
 * AgriPulse Telemetry Gateway — client setup
 *
 * This block initializes the gateway client that forwards tractor and
 * harvester telemetry from field units to the central FleetView service.
 * Support team: if units show as offline, verify the gateway process is
 * running and that its clock is within 30 seconds of true time, since
 * FleetView rejects stale-signed payloads. The client authenticates to
 * the internal FleetView ingest endpoint with the key below.
 */

gateway credential: kto7_GoY89Me